#1
|
|||
|
|||
crear txt y subir al servidor
Buenas, tengo que hacer una select, y con los resultados, meterlos en un txt y dejarlos en el servidor de sap, y una vez echo eso, llamar a un programa que tengo ya echo y que lo suba al ftp, alguien sabe algo de subir al servidor???????
|
#2
|
||||
|
||||
Hola.
si lo que quieres es dejar un fichero en el servidor SAP no puedes utilizar el WS_DOWNLOAD y debes usar la sentencia OPEN DATASET. **Debes declararte una constante con el path: DATA app_path TYPE localfile VALUE '/rutadetuservidor'. **Una variable tipo string que contendrá las lineas del fichero plano v_str TYPE string. **Abres el fichero: OPEN DATASET app_path FOR OUTPUT IN TEXT MODE ENCODING DEFAULT. **Aqui dentro haces un loop como este ejemplo LOOP AT it_empleados. CONCATENATE it_empleados-numero it_empleados-nombre it_empleados-apellidos it_empleados-linea it_empleados-categoria it_empleados-estado it_empleados-operacion INTO v_str SEPARATED BY cl_abap_char_utilities=>horizontal_tab. TRANSFER v_str TO app_path. CLEAR: v_str, it_empleados. ENDLOOP. ***Cierras el fichero y listo. CLOSE DATASET app_pathcopy. Un saludo!! Espero te sirva de algo |
#3
|
|||
|
|||
Hola te escribe Juan Valdez. Gran aporte el tuyo y bastante simple, solo me quede con una duda, como enviar los datos sin que aparezcan separados por el simbolo de numero? Slaudos. |
Herramientas | Buscar en Tema |
Desplegado | |
|
|